The Sleeping Giant Has Awakened

Last Thursday, we had a power packed and exciting advocacy meeting with about 30 area nonprofit and key business leaders in the Grand Forks commuity. The excitement and interest is brewing. We decided as nonprofit leaders we have a duty and interest in creating a stronger voice and creating a place at the table where decisions are made and policy is put into place. We were also encouraged by business leaders to celebrate and articulate our success to our community.

This initial meeting identified three goals:
1. Solidarity
2. Education and information sharing with the public
3. Present and develop policy agenda

We underestimate the power and influence we have by the quality work, great minds and impact we make in our community. We need to celebrate our success and articulate the work we do in our communities, both socially and economically.
